I think his missing chances is just another sign of his body being out of kilter with what he’s used to in his mind. 
 

At the highest level, such fine margins count. If his legs move a millisecond slower than they did before, if his balance is slightly off because he’s lost some flexibility, if his touch is slightly worse. These are all things that impact. 
 

He may adapt yet again and become a pure poacher like Cottee was for us (bagging 10-13 prem goals a season) but I don’t think we’ll see a prolonged purple patch like Vardy of old again.

 

That’s not to say that he doesn’t contribute or shouldn’t be in the side. He still brings plenty of assists - as he has always done - but that’s the kind of thing that will look great when thrown in with a ‘goal involvement’ stat combined with Iheanacho but doesn’t tell the full story of watching him week in week out for the last few months. Right now he just doesn’t have the goals he’s usually had in recent years to go with it and he’s missing chances he wouldn’t even blink at before.

 

He’s the LCFC GOAT but it’s not abuse or fickle to say that we think he might not be the player we have come to know anymore.
